We are building a chronic condition management platform that integrates with Allscripts EMRs. It identifies gaps in patient care, develops personalized care plans, and enables ongoing patient education and monitoring between visits. The platform aims to address the gap between great physician instruction and meaningful patient action. It utilizes CMS financial incentives for coordinated care and Allscripts APIs to integrate within clinical workflows and exchange data with patients. There is potential for significant impact given the large problem of heart disease and gaps in patient self-management, as well as meaningful provider incentives and patient readiness with smartphones.

We are using the CMS Coordinated Care incentive to drive
provider adoption and deliver premium education
• Beginning in January 2015, the CMS Coordinated Care incentive will pay
providers $40/patient/month enrolled in HEARTPartner
• Pershing Yoakley & Associates (Healthcare Consulting/EMR Audit)
estimates the total potential value to a cardiologist of ~$1.2MM/year – this
is enough to get the attention of potential adopters
• Our agreement with providers includes that $40 in the first month be
spent against the patient’s education program in the form of educational
materials (e.g., the books we digitize), the partial purchase of a
monitoring device or diet program
Economic incentives + EMR integration solve the two
biggest challenges to implementations
Common Roadblock #1: “It’s not in the budget!”
Because of the CMS incentive, now it’s in the budget, but as a revenue
source, not a cost.
Common Roadblock #2: “It’s not in our patient workflow…”
Allscripts integration enables context-aware access to the HEARTPartner
program with both active and passive data exchange with patients. We are in
the flow.

We used the the Allscripts API to identify patient trends,
update patient-supplied cardio data and store reports
• For this code-a-thon we are using the Professional API
• We used GetServerInfo and GetUserAuthentication as part of the setup
• GetChangedPatients + GetPatient + GetClinicalSummary is used to build
the trend graphs and populate the heart health assessment
• SaveDocumentImage is used to save a printable version of the
Archimedes Heart Health Assessment
• GetSchedule is used to grab patients with appointments in the next week
• GetPatientSections + SaveVitalsData is used to add patient-generated
data to EMR (we use both to support de-duping of data)
Potential for Impact = Size of Problem X Adoption
• 1 in 3 deaths from heart disease, $300B+ in costs, #1 cause of preventable
death in people 40-65, 2MM+ heart attacks/strokes a year. IT’S BIG
• A recent Medscape survey of Cardiologists “half my patients don’t do
anything I tell them”. THERE IS A BIG GAP BETWEEN GREAT PHYSICIAN
INSTRUCTION AND POWERFUL PATIENT ACTION
• The incentives for implementing a coordinated care/remote monitoring
for GPs and Cardiologists range from $200K to $1MM per provider.
MEANINGFUL PROVIDER INCENTIVES IN PLACE
• Smartphone penetration: 45-54 (71%), 55-64 (61%), 65+ (46%).
Americans over 65 sent 4 Trillion text messages last year. TARGET
PATIENT SHOWS READINESS AND CAPABILITY
